Terminalia catappa (Indian Almond tree)

Terminalia Catappas also referred to as the indian almond tree are thick, branching, deciduous tree, branches of young plant forming horizontal whorls, broad-based obovate, luscious, deep green leaves, 25 cm long, borne in branch-like clusters, turn red before dropping. Petalless flowers have white calyxes, with tubes up to 1 cm long, borne in axillary spikes, up to 16 centimeters long, in summer; followed by narrow-winged, ellipsoid, red, yellow or green fruit, 5-7 cm long, with edible tasty seeds.

Common Name Indian Almond
Botanical Name Terminalia catappa
Height 20-35m
Spread 15-20m
Origin Tropical Asia, Malaysia, N. Australia, Polynesia
Category Trees
Family Combretaceae
Flower Colour White
Drought Tolerance High
Salinity Tolerance Medium
Sun Tolerance High
Wind Tolerance High
Water-Log Tolerance Medium
pH Level Basic
Pest Tolerance High
Disease Tolerance High
Growth Rate Medium
Fragrance No
Growth Habit Spreading
